Output 52b4dbefb6db885c5fd867fbbabae3584435f557d30f22fa88297e114ac5728e:305

value
165688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 648c23e756c4704c6d4b9bf784e9d33a5a83c21d OP_EQUAL
address
3ArfNqnfoWWd6LoEUpmL7966Bs6HkEbhR9
transaction
52b4dbefb6db885c5fd867fbbabae3584435f557d30f22fa88297e114ac5728e
spent
true